In seven weeks I'll be headed to Memphis for the Anime Blues Con, where I'll be sitting in on comics and animation panels to discuss many things, including my Portal animated short, "Companionship" (working title).
Portal Short Chell Test Render by alexzemke
At that convention, I'll also be announcing the launch of my Kickstarter.com page to raise funds for it! Chell's rig is getting a makeover from the ground up, being redone by an actual feature film pro, rather than my buddies trying to learn The Setup Machine as they go. She's getting such a tremendous tune-up, and she is gonna be awesome!!! Lithe and limber, like a good Chell should be!

So that guy's going to cost money. Also, I shouldn't try to do music and sound effects by myself. It's been well over a decade since my radio production days, and I never had to take on something like this. More money! And matt painting! More money! And if these guys are getting paid, then the animators should damn well get something! More money!

I've got a few notions about backer rewards (the incentive gifts that give back to the donors who helped make the film possible), but I'd love to hear ideas from others. I'm looking into the possibility of Chell figurines, 3D printed from the film's character rig, posed all cool and action-y... as a high-end backer reward, of course.
